All depends on timing I guess. Budget permitting, grab whatever you can get yours hand on if you need a new system now. RTX3070, RTX3080, Radeon RX6800, Radeon RX6800XT. (stay away from the RTX3090 though, way too expensive for what you get). They’re all in pretty short supply right now.
If you’re not in a hurry (and we’re talking about a couple of months here), you can dive deeper and watch more review/benchmarkt to see what fits your needs most. And whatever you do, don’t pay scalper prices.
If you need something right now, you can also look into a 2000 series NVidia card, or maybe a Radeon 5700XT. Just compare their prices to the newer offerings, and don’t get carried away.
I’m running a Ryzen 5 3600 CPU with a Radeon RX5700XT right now. It’s not amazing compared to the new releases, but I can run the game quite well on 1440P (mix of high and ultra settings), so there’s really no need to break the bank right now. Might grab an upgrade myself in the future though, mostly for VR (more around the 4K realm), but in reality, my current system runs the sim just fine, so don’t overspend if your budget is limited.
